Abstract

A showcase designed to retain stable cooling performance in the case where the states of temperature as well as moisture of the air outside a commodity storage section entering the commodity storage section from respective openings are different has a showcase body having openings in at least two of its front side, rear side and left and right sides; a commodity storage section provided in the showcase body, a bottom-side air passage having an air inlet along a lower end of each opening; a side air passage extending upward along one side of the commodity storage section from the bottom-side air passage; a commodity cooling air passage formed so as to extend from the side air passage toward the other side, having an air outlets in each of the openings sides, a blower for causing air to flow from each of the air inlet into the bottom-side air passage; a cooler provided inside the bottom-side air passage for cooling the air flowing into the bottom-side air passage; and a air guiding section for guiding the air flowing from each of the air inlet to the bottom-side air passage to the air inflowing side of the cooler, whereby the air flowing from each of the air inlet is guided to the air inflowing side of the cooler so as to cool the commodity storage section with a cooling apparatus in a simple structure having one cooler.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
1 . A showcase comprising: 
 a showcase body having openings in at least two of its front side, rear side and left and right sides;    a commodity storage section provided in the showcase body;    a bottom-side air passage having an air inlet along a lower end of each of the openings;    a side air passage extending upward along one side of the commodity storage section from the bottom-side air passage;    a commodity cooling air passage formed so as to extend from the side air passage toward the other side, having an air outlet in each of the openings sides;    a blower for causing air to flow from each of the air inlet into the bottom-side air passage;    a cooler provided inside the bottom-side air passage for cooling the air flowing into the bottom-side air passage; and    an air guiding section for guiding the air flowing from each of the air inlet to the bottom-side air passage to the air inflowing side of the cooler.    
   
   
       2 . The showcase according to  claim 1 , wherein: 
 said air guiding section consist of a first bottom-side air passage formed along each of the air inlet of a bottom-side air passage, a second bottom-side air passage provided at the bottom of bottom-side air passage other than the first bottom-side air passage where the air to flow through the first bottom-side air passage flows in, and a third bottom-side air passage provided upward the second bottom-side air passage with a cooler and a blower being disposed thereon so the air flowing through the second bottom-side air passage flows in.    
   
   
       3 . The showcase according to  claim 2 , comprising: 
 a rectifying section for setting the air flowing from said each air inlet to the bottom-side air passage at a uniform flow rate in the widthwise direction of each of the air inlet.    
   
   
       4 . The showcase according to  claim 3 , wherein: 
 said rectifying section consist of a partition plate for partitioning the first bottom-side air passage and the second bottom-side air passage and a plurality of communication holes provided in the partition plate to bring the first bottom-side air passage and the second bottom-side air passage into communication so that the opening ratio in the partition plate at long distance from the blower gets larger than the opening ratio in the partition plate at short distance from the blower.    
   
   
       5 . The showcase according to  claim 2 , comprising: 
 a drain pan, provided below said cooler, having a drainage receiving portion consisting of a inclined face where drainage derived in the cooler flows in a predetermined direction and a drainage port provided at the lowest bottom of the drainage receiving portion.    
   
   
       6 . The showcase according to  claim 5 , wherein: 
 said drain pan has a plurality of drainage receiving portions and drainage ports.    
   
   
       7 . The showcase according to  claim 6 , wherein: 
 said each of the drainage receiving portions is mutually disposed in the longitudinal direction of the drain pan.    
   
   
       8 . The showcase according to  claim 1 , comprising: 
 a flow dividing section for making the flow rate of the air flowing out from each of the air outlet uniform in the widthwise direction of each of the air outlet.    
   
   
       9 . The showcase according to  claim 8 , wherein: 
 said flow dividing section consist of a plurality of air guiding plates provided on the top or the bottom inside the commodity cooling air passage so as to go perpendicular to the air flowing direction and mutually disposed at an interval in the air flowing direction, and    each of the air guiding plates is longer in size in the vertical direction than the adjacent air guiding plate in the upstream side in the air flowing direction.    
   
   
       10 . The showcase according to  claim 9 , wherein: 
 each of the air guiding plates is inclined so as to direct its tip portion in the air flowing direction.    
   
   
       11 . The showcase according to  claim 2 , wherein: 
 said cooler consists of a tube provided with a plurality of bent portions in order to let refrigerant flow in a direction perpendicular to the blowing direction of the blower, a plurality of fins provided in the tube so as to extend in the blowing direction of the blower, a pair of side plates with each bent portion of the tube being present through them and covering sides of the fins, and a hermetically sealed member provided between sides of the fins end and each of the side plates; and    a part of the side of the third bottom-side air passage is formed by each of the side plates.
